from fastapi import FastAPI
from pydantic import BaseModel
from supabase import create_client, Client
import os
import gradio as gr
import requests

# --- Supabase Config ---
SUPABASE_URL = os.getenv("SUPABASE_URL")
SUPABASE_KEY = os.getenv("SUPABASE_KEY")
supabase: Client = create_client(SUPABASE_URL, SUPABASE_KEY)

# --- FastAPI Setup ---
app = FastAPI()

# --- Pydantic Task Model ---
class Task(BaseModel):
    title: str
    completed: bool = False

# --- API Endpoints ---
@app.post("/tasks/")
def add_task(task: Task):
    response = supabase.table("tasks").insert(task.dict()).execute()
    return response.data

@app.get("/tasks/")
def get_tasks():
    response = supabase.table("tasks").select("*").order("id", desc=False).execute()
    return response.data

@app.patch("/tasks/{task_id}")
def update_task(task_id: str, completed: bool):
    response = supabase.table("tasks").update({"completed": completed}).eq("id", task_id).execute()
    return response.data

@app.delete("/tasks/{task_id}")
def delete_task(task_id: str):
    supabase.table("tasks").delete().eq("id", task_id).execute()
    return {"detail": "Task deleted"}

# --- Gradio Frontend Logic ---
API_URL = "http://localhost:7860"  # adjust if needed for Hugging Face Spaces

def get_tasks_data():
    response = requests.get(f"{API_URL}/tasks/")
    return response.json()

def get_task_choices():
    """Returns [(label, uuid)] for the dropdown."""
    tasks = get_tasks_data()
    return [(f"{t['title']} - {'✔️' if t['completed'] else '❌'}", t['id']) for t in tasks]

def get_task_display():
    """Returns formatted list of tasks for display."""
    return [f"{t['title']} - {'✔️' if t['completed'] else '❌'}" for t in get_tasks_data()]

def add_task_ui(title):
    if not title.strip():
        return "Title cannot be empty", get_task_display(), gr.update(choices=get_task_choices())
    requests.post(f"{API_URL}/tasks/", json={"title": title, "completed": False})
    return "", get_task_display(), gr.update(choices=get_task_choices())

def complete_task_ui(task_id):
    requests.patch(f"{API_URL}/tasks/{task_id}", params={"completed": True})
    return get_task_display(), gr.update(choices=get_task_choices())

def delete_task_ui(task_id):
    requests.delete(f"{API_URL}/tasks/{task_id}")
    return get_task_display(), gr.update(choices=get_task_choices())

# --- Gradio UI ---
with gr.Blocks() as demo:
    gr.Markdown("## ✅ Task List Manager")

    with gr.Row():
        task_input = gr.Textbox(label="New Task", placeholder="e.g., Write blog post")
        add_button = gr.Button("Add Task")

    task_selector = gr.Dropdown(label="Select a Task", choices=[])

    with gr.Row():
        complete_button = gr.Button("Mark as Completed")
        delete_button = gr.Button("Delete Task")

    task_display = gr.Textbox(label="All Tasks", lines=10)

    # Button Logic
    add_button.click(add_task_ui, inputs=task_input, outputs=[task_input, task_display, task_selector])
    complete_button.click(complete_task_ui, inputs=task_selector, outputs=[task_display, task_selector])
    delete_button.click(delete_task_ui, inputs=task_selector, outputs=[task_display, task_selector])

    # Load initial data
    demo.load(
        lambda: (
            get_task_display(),
            gr.update(choices=get_task_choices())
        ),
        outputs=[task_display, task_selector]
    )

# Mount Gradio app into FastAPI
app = gr.mount_gradio_app(app, demo, path="/")
